Following the March incident where Glimmerdeck served week-old pricing pages, we reviewed cache sizing and eviction behavior. The root cause was a TTL that exceeded the upstream invalidation window, combined with an undersized refresh worker pool that fell behind during peak traffic. Support should know that stale reads are now bounded: any entry older than the hard ceiling is dropped on read. Headroom was added for the Pellworth launch. The revised constants, which govern alert thresholds, are listed below:

tuning table, yajog-yahof:
BUDGETS = {
    "lamvan": 303,
    "wenox": 460,
    "fenvan": 525,
}

- [ ] **Step 7: Breaker override escrow.** After sealing the signing keys for the Tallgrove upstream API circuit breaker, confirm the support team can force the breaker open during a full outage. The override bundle lives in the sealed escrow drawer and is useless without its unlock phrase. Two ceremony witnesses must initial this step before proceeding. The escrow bundle is decrypted with the recovery passphrase that follows.

vault phrase of kahip-kahop = holath-quenmir

**Mgmt Meeting Minutes — Retiring the Brightline Range**

Quick recap for sales leads at Fenholt Supplies: we agreed to retire the Brightline fixture range by year-end. Remaining stock moves to clearance pricing next month, and accounts on standing orders get migrated to the Lumetta range. Trade-in incentives were approved in principle. The confidential note on next steps sits just below.

board note of bajof-bajeg: The pricing group signed off on a budget of $13.4 million for Project Sildor. The renewal with Lamixek Holdings closes at $48.9 million a year, 49 percent above the last contract.